WebHow you can use certain mutable types to pass by reference in Python; What the best practices are for replicating pass by reference in Python; Free Bonus: 5 Thoughts On … WebJan 13, 2024 · The assumption of this purpose is wrong, self (instance variable) is supposed to be used if you define an instance method. According to pylint: method_could_be_a_function: If a function could be run without self (instance variable), it should be an individual function, not an instance method. For example:
The pass Statement: How to Do Nothing in Python
WebFeb 25, 2016 · If you know that your decorator is always going to be called by a class method, you can also do this (and I also encourage the use of functools.wraps ): def will_change_state(f): @functools.wraps(f) def wrapper(self, *args, **kwargs): ret = f(self, *args, **kwargs) self.change_state() return ret return wrapper Increasing readability never … WebIn Python, the pass keyword is an entire statement in itself. This statement doesn’t do anything: it’s discarded during the byte-compile phase. But for a statement that does … hairdressers front st chester le street
How to use self in Python – explained with examples
WebUsing self in a driver is not as straight forward as thought, though it is really easy once you know where to put it. In short: In your driver, simply don't declare a variable, but use self in the expression itself to reference to the object. Check this screenshot here: This driver is hooked up to the scale.y property of an object. WebIn Python, the pass keyword is an entire statement in itself. This statement doesn’t do anything: it’s discarded during the byte-compile phase. But for a statement that does nothing, the Python pass statement is surprisingly useful. Sometimes pass is useful in the final code that runs in production. WebDec 28, 2024 · self is the first method of every Python class. When Python calls a method in your class, it will pass in the actual instance of that class that you're working with as the … hairdressers forestside